The League of Gentlemen (1999–2017)
10/10
Weird, sick but very, very funny
10 February 2002
I first flicked onto the LoG accidentally one night while waching television: since then, I have never missed an episode.

It's humour is very weird, like a cross between Brass Eye's social commentary, the Fast Show's excellent one-liners, and an amazing plot that seems to develop each week without ever going anywhere. The best example of this was Hillary Briss's special stuff - what was that all about?

The humour will not appeal to all. Some will say it's just too sick, and it's easy to see where they're coming from. Nonetheless, give it a try. If you don't like it, don't watch it, but if you do like it you'll be very glad you took my advice.
